The endocrine system is a collection of glands that produce the hormones that regulate metabolism, growth and development, tissue function, sexual function, reproduction, sleep, and mood, among all the other things

Water soluble hormones associate with the G protein of cAMP. This G protein is intra-cellular i.e found inside the cell.
However in case of lipid derived hormones, the hormone has to diffuse through the cell across the plasma membrane to bind to DNA or the intra-cellular receptors.This regulates the gene transcription and induces protein production that affects the cell functioning for a long time.

Again, please give the choices but if a patient with an NGT drinks a fluid (such as water) it will NOT cause Sodium retention, but depletion. The water will pull the electrolytes from the stomach and the NGT would suck the fluid and electrolytes.
